ALEXANDRIA CAMPUS
Fort Myer (FTM)
This Military Site Office (MSO) is located in Arlington—from
I-395 or Route 50 take Washington Blvd. and enter Fort Myer at
Second Street (Hatfield Gate). For directions, maps, and information
on base access, go to the MSO Web site at www.nvcc.edu/alexandria/military/index.htm or call the NVCC Fort Myer office at (703) 527-5976. Active duty,
active reserve and military dependents have priority for registration
for these courses, however, non-DoD, NVCC students may also register.
Classes are held in buildings 219, 230, 232, and 404. Building
and room assignments are posted in Building 219 and can also be
found on the MSO Web site’s “Schedule” page.
Classes will not meet on federal holidays.

Nursing and Allied Health Programs —In order to
register for courses in the DNH, EMT (except EMT 106, 196), MLT,
NUR, PTH (except PTH 100), RAD, and RTH programs, you must have
been previously accepted and have selected a major in these specific
health programs and have division approval. The Health Careers
Opportunity Program (HCOP) provides grant-funded assistance to
Allied Health students who are academically or economically disadvantaged.
The program implements retention strategies, as well as case management
for HCOP participants enrolled in health technology programs. For
additional information on HCOP, call 703-822-6531.
